Health Insurance Can You Afford To Be Without It?

You eat a well-balanced diet plan, you workout, you rest and you try not too stress, but is this enough to preserve your health? Scientist would say no it is not, especially if you have family history of a particular disease. That is not to say that living a more healthy life-style is likely to make no difference to your wellbeing, in fact almost all diseases are warded off with a more healthy life-style, however you will find moments when your best efforts are not good enough. For instance there are people who have a history of a specific disease and who discover that they develop the ailment irrespective of living a health lifestyle. Or someone who is super fit might develop health difficulties because of accident or a contracted illness.

The truth is that nobody can predict what precisely will occur in the future and no person could be 100 % certain that their efforts will safe guard them from harm. What we can be certain about however is that should something happen which places our health in jeopardy we will have to purchase health care and spending money on health-care is not something that everybody can afford. The truth is that most countries do not have health care plans which provide proper health care for the general public. In most nations around the world those who do not have plenty of cash rely on the government health care system, and because of the way which these systems are designed there is often backlogs of folks waiting on health-care. Minimal resources and large number of people seeking medical care causes many people needing to wait several months in order to have a surgical treatment done.

The other alternative would be having private medical care. The private medical care is costly and can only be afforded by people who either have the cash or by people who are on some sort of medical aid coverage. Many companies have mandatory medical aid packages, but nevertheless this is a very small percentage of the populace. Medical aid schemes and health insurance differ in that these are governed by different acts and they furthermore differ in the way they pay-out.

Health insurance is a product which is offered by insurance carriers and is governed by the Insurance Act. There are a number of various health insurance plans on the market and each have differ in price and insurance coverage. The more expensive the health insurance scheme the more the comprehensive the coverage.
Having health insurance implies that in return for month-to-month payments your health insurance provider will provide you with a pre-determined amount of cash to pay for your health care requirements. You will discover however that it does not assure you against all kinds of health issues only particular kinds so ensure that you know what the advantages of the insurance item you are buying is.
The simplest way to buy health insurance which is suited to you would be to talk with a health insurance expert.

Point Pleasant Title Insurance A Form of Indemnity Insurance

TitleInsurance is a legal way to secure a land property from any outside attack. TitleInsurance is a form of indemnity insurance. Point Pleasant is a borough in the States and the Point Pleasant TitleInsurance offers legal security to the real estate of Point Pleasant.

Any form of titleinsurance concerns either of the two parties that have direct relation to a real estate. One is the lender and the other is the owner. However, there is a good deal of difference between the natures of the titleinsurance policies of the two parties. A lender who deals with lands located in Point Pleasant will have a form specifically for construction loans. This legal aspect is part of the titleinsurance policy that the lender will have.
On the other hand, the owner's titleinsurance policy assures the buyer that the property he/she is going to buy is undisputed. The titleinsurance policy of PointPleasant will assure you as a buyer that the titled property is free of any defect and damage. If there is any lien or encumbrance over the titled land prior to your purchase, you will be informed of those factors officially and legally in the title insurance policy. The policy will enlist the burdens that the real estate already has on it before the official transaction is completed. This transparency in the PointPleasant insurance policy will enable you to face the problems with prior knowledge of the possible forthcoming difficulties. The result will be that you will not feel cheated and helpless when any such difficulty will crop up before you regarding the ownership of and construction on your newly purchased land in PointPleasant.

PointPleasant Title Insurance policy also supports the lender and the owner of real estate properties financially in times of dire need. The policy clearly mentions which liabilities or encumbrances are part of the coverage that the policy offers and which are not. Based on these terms the lender or the owner of the land might receive reimbursement if he or she suffers from a great financial loss due to any dispute on the concerned land. Any new purchaser of land in PointPleasant should, therefore, read the title insurance policy very carefully and in detail before submitting to it. A thorough consultation with the title insurance agent of Point Pleasant about the ownership and the transaction of a particular plot of land might help a great deal in this matter.

Life Insurance After Retirement

A lot of people think that with retirement and the presumed settled financial situation the need for life insurance reduces or disappears completely. This is not necessarily so but with retirement, the need changes and it may not be the priority it once was. And yet many continue with their policies, but often for the wrong reasons. One of the most common is force of habit - "I've always had life insurance so how can I stop?" This is the wrong reason. When you sell a car after many years you don't feel bad about the end of the insurance for the car. You are happy that you had the coverage while you needed it. While your life is far more valuable than a car or a house, the same logic applies. You must know when you need life insurance and when it is not required. Answering the following questions should help to give you a clearer idea of your post-retirement insurance needs.

Is Life Insurance Necessary?

The answer to this question lies in another one. Will anyone sufferer financial loss when you die? If the answer is no, then you probably don't need it. For example, take the case of a couple with a steady income, sufficient for their needs, from the investments they have made over the years. This income will continue even after one of them dies, so what will be gained from a life insurance policy? On the other hand, if one person is involved in activities that bring in additional income on top of the investment returns, then the loss of this may need to be compensated by insurance.

But Do You Want Life Insurance?

Okay, you may not need life coverage, but the idea of leaving something for your family or a favorite charity when you die can be attractive. For a small monthly outgo, the amount you leave can change the lives of a lot of people or give a worthwhile cause a huge boost.

If You Do Need Insurance, How Much Do You Need?

If you do need life insurance after retirement, you should now the amount you require. Calculate the financial loss that others will feel upon your death. What amount of money will they need to provide them a regular income that will enable them to continue to live as they did while you were alive? This is the amount of life insurance you should have.

How Long Will You Need It?

The answer to this question depends on when you take the policy. The earlier you take it -.i.e. the younger you are - and the longer the duration of the policy, the lower will be the monthly payment. So it makes sense to take a life insurance policy as soon as you can. This will cover your family from a loss in income if you should die. If your planned retirement is 25 years in the future, then the policy should be for at least that length of time. Adding on a few more years will provide you a cushion if things don't work out exactly as planned. And the additional cost will be minimal.
